  1. A Comical Cure Megan Arthur

  2. Thesis Statement The act of laughter is tremendously beneficial in both physical and psychological aspects, as well as in building interaction skills.

  3. Background of Laughter Gelotology • The study of laughter Three types of laughter • The incongruity theory • The superiority theory • The relief theory Parts of the brain involved with laughter • the left side of the cortex, the frontal lobe, the sensory area of the occipital lobe, the hippocampus, the motory sections

  4. Physically Beneficial • Strengthens the Immune System • Respiratory and Cardiovascular systems • Pain reduction

  5. Psychologically Beneficial • Positive attitude, optimism • Stress reduction • Laughter Therapy

  6. Skill Building • Productivity • Communication, interaction • Interpersonal relationships
